The cast considered this movie to be an unofficial sequel to Grosse Pointe Blank (1997). Five actors appeared in both films: John Cusack, Joan Cusack, Bill Cusack, Dan Aykroyd, and Doug Dearth.
The corporation, Tamerlane, refers to Timur, known in the West as Tamerlane. Timur conquered a great deal of central and western Asia in the 14th Century and founded the Timurid Empire and Timurid dynasty.

The An-12B airplane shown at the beginning and end of the movie is owned and operated by Bright Aviation Services, based in Sofia, Bulgaria. Along with some other Bulgarian freight carriers, they are banned from operating in Norway, Iceland, Switzerland, and the European Union countries because of their safety record.
